When one spouse has a much larger Social Security benefit, the timing decision can make a big difference, especially when there’s an age gap. 👀
Sometimes it may make sense for the lower-earning spouse to start sooner, while the higher-earning spouse waits to increase their monthly benefit. Why? Because that larger benefit could eventually become the surviving spouse’s benefit later on.
But there’s no one-size-fits-all answer here. Your ages, work status, health, benefit amounts, and long-term income needs all matter. 🧾
